Energy: The distance of offshore wind turbines near the coast is a matter of debate

To decarbonize the economy, we must also develop renewable energies. The law to simplify the process will be examined in the legislature next week. Senators abandoned the ban on wind turbines within 40km of the coast, which had already been approved. It was not unanimous, especially at Dunkirk.

A distance of 12 km separates the coast from the first offshore wind farm already operating near Saint-Nazaire (Loire-Atlantique). Wind turbines It is clearly visible. Within five years, on a beach at Dunkirk (Nord), there will be 46 wind turbines 11 km from the coast. This displeases the locals.It is better not to put anything“, says a man.

Senators are Republican (LR) attempted to push future parks more than 40 km from the coast. Instead, after consulting with local elected officials, the government was able to introduce a simple incentive to build wind turbines offshore beyond 22 km. Building wind turbines further away from the coast requires digging deeper under the sea. Which can be complicated. But LR representatives can bring the issue back on the menu of discussions in the National Assembly.
